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our team will arrive at your office building within 60 minutes, equipped with the latest equipment to assess the damage and create a plan to extract the water. We’ll identify the source of the leak and develop a strategy to stop it. This ensures that the water doesn’t continue to cause dam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using powerful pumps and vacuums, we’ll extract the water from your office building, starting with the affected areas and working our way up. We’ll remove standing water and wet materials reducing the risk of mold and bacterial grow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our team will set up dr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ture from the air, walls, and floors. We’ll ensure your office building is completely dry and free of moisture preventing further damage and ensuring a healthy environment for your employees.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our team will thoroughly clean and sanitize all affected areas, removing any debris, dirt, or bacteria that may have been left behind. We’ll leave your office building smelling fresh and clean ready for occupancy.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Certificate of Completion
Before we leave,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that all work has been completed to your satisfaction. We’ll provide a certificate of completion guaranteeing that your office building is safe and secure for you and your employees to return to work.

Warning Signs You Need Office Building Water Extraction
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Be on the lookout for these common signs of water damage: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and bacteria. Don’t ignore musty smells – they can be a sign of a more serious issue. Our team will investigate and provide a solution to remove the odor and pr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ause flooring to become warped or buckled. This can lead to further damage and safety hazards. Our team will assess the damage and provide a solution to repair or replace the affected flooring.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Water damage can cause paint or wallpaper to peel or bubble. This can be a sign of underlying moisture issues. Our team will investigate and provide a solution to repair or replace the affected materials.
Discoloration or Stains
Water damage can cause discoloration or stains on walls, ceilings, and floors. Don’t ignore these signs – they can be a sign of a more serious issue. Our team will assess the damage and provide a solution to repair or replace the affected areas.
Leaks or Water Spots
Leaks or water spots on walls, ceilings, or floors can show the presence of water damage. Don’t ignore these signs – they can lead to costly repairs and health hazards. Our team will investigate and provide a solution to repair or replace the affected areas.
